I am told there are two bills at the desk due for their first reading. The PRESIDING OFFICER. The clerk will report the bills by title. The legislative clerk read as follows: A bill (H.R. 674) to amend the Internal Revenue Code of 1986 to repeal the imposition of 3 percent withholding on certain payments made to vendors by government entities, to modify the calculation of modified adjusted gross income for purposes of determining eligibility for certain health care- related programs, and for other purposes. A bill (S. 1769) to put workers back on the job while rebuilding and modernizing America.
